Cereal crops utilise more nutrients. Hence, a pulse crop is grown between two cereal crops, to compensate for the loss of nutrients.
Pulses are leguminous plants which are capable of restoring soil fertility by means of their symbiotic root nodules. This method of cultivating more than one crop in the same field is termed as mixed cropping.
